Mobile Caretaker
Are you practical, reliable, and passionate about keeping communities clean, safe, and well-maintained?
Join Hightown Housing Association, a charitable organisation committed to building homes and supporting people across Hertfordshire, Buckinghamshire, and Berkshire.
About the Role
As a Mobile Caretaker, you will play a vital role in maintaining our housing schemes and communal areas to a high standard.
- You will be responsible for
- Regular visits to care, supported housing, and general needs sites
- Low-level maintenance tasks and repairs
- Grounds maintenance including grass cutting, strimming, and leaf blowing
- Waste collection and disposal from bin stores and communal areas
- PAT testing and emergency equipment checks
- Supporting estate improvements and working closely with our maintenance and housing teams
- Equipment stock checks
- Clean/unblock drains, gullies, sinks, toilets as necessary
- What we are Looking For
- Experience in maintenance, caretaking, or grounds work
- Confidence in carrying out DIY-level repairs and using garden tools
- A full UK driving licence and willingness to travel between sites
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team
- Commitment to excellent customer service and Hightown’s values
Desirable Skills
- Experience with Housing Associations or Local Authorities
- Knowledge of health and safety requirements
- Experience in the collection and disposal of waste in a work environment

✨Get Your Hands Dirty
In skilled trades, practical experience is everything. Consider volunteering or doing odd jobs in your area to build up your skills and visibility. Local businesses often appreciate helping hands and it might just lead to a full-time gig!
✨Join Trade Associations
Look into joining organisations specific to your trade (like the National Federation of Builders or similar). They often have job boards, networking events, and apprenticeships that can put you in touch with employers who value skilled workers. Plus, being part of these communities adds credibility to your profiles!
✨Showcase Your Work Online
Craft a portfolio that highlights your craftsmanship—before and after photos, project descriptions, and client testimonials are all golden! Share this on platforms that cater to skilled trades, like Instagram or dedicated forums, to attract potential employers looking for your skillset.
✨Apply Directly and Follow Up
Don’t just rely on job boards—visit local businesses, introduce yourself, and drop off your CV. Building rapport face-to-face can work wonders in the skilled trades sector. And remember, following up after applying through our website shows dedication; it might just give you an edge over other candidates!

✨Master the Hands-On Skills
In skilled trades, practical skills matter a ton. Be ready to showcase your hands-on abilities during the interview—whether it's through a practical test or a demonstration of your craftsmanship. Bring your best examples of past projects to discuss them in detail!
✨Know Your Tools Like the Back of Your Hand
Employers in the skilled trades often want to hear about your proficiency with specific tools and equipment. Brush up on the tools relevant to your field and be prepared to discuss your experiences using them. This shows you’re not just experienced but also safe and competent.
✨Be Ready to Talk About Safety Practices
Safety is paramount in skilled trades. Be prepared to discuss your knowledge of safety regulations and how you've implemented them in previous roles. This will demonstrate your commitment to a safe working environment—a quality that employers highly value.
✨Show Off Your Problem-Solving Skills
When tackling skilled trade roles, employers want to know about your ability to think on your feet. Be ready with examples of how you've solved unexpected problems on the job.
